What men’s circulation supplements are meant to do

Most men’s circulation supplements are designed to support nitric oxide production, vascular function, and healthy blood vessel relaxation. In plain terms, the goal is to help your body move blood more efficiently where it needs to go. That can mean a better training pump, improved exercise endurance, and stronger support for intimate performance.

But expectations matter. A supplement is not a shortcut around poor sleep, high stress, smoking, heavy drinking, or a sedentary routine. The best formulas act like performance support, not magic. They work best when your training, hydration, and recovery are at least reasonably dialed in.

The ingredients that matter most

A good guide to men’s circulation supplements starts with the label. Fancy branding means very little if the ingredient profile is weak, underdosed, or hidden behind a vague proprietary blend.

L-arginine

L-arginine is one of the better-known blood flow ingredients because it helps support nitric oxide production. That matters for vascular relaxation and circulation. Some men notice better workout pumps and mild performance benefits, but results can be inconsistent because arginine is not always absorbed efficiently.

L-citrulline

L-citrulline is often a stronger choice for nitric oxide support because the body can convert it into arginine over time. For many men, citrulline is the more reliable ingredient for pump, endurance, and blood flow support. If a formula is built for circulation and training performance, this is one of the first ingredients worth looking for.

Beet root

Beet root is popular for a reason. It provides natural nitrates that support nitric oxide pathways and can help with exercise performance and blood flow. It is a solid fit for men who want a more plant-based route in their circulation stack.

Pine bark and antioxidant support

Ingredients like pine bark extract are often used to support vascular health and help manage oxidative stress. This matters because circulation is not only about opening blood vessels. It is also about protecting the system that keeps blood moving efficiently over time.

Ginseng and adaptogenic support

Some circulation formulas include ginseng or similar adaptogens. These ingredients are not pure nitric oxide boosters, but they may support energy, stamina, stress response, and sexual wellness. For men dealing with long workdays, hard training, and low drive, that broader support can be useful.

What benefits are realistic

The strongest circulation supplements usually support performance in overlapping ways. Better blood flow can help you feel more ready in the gym, more resilient during long days, and more confident when intimacy matters.

For training, the most common upside is improved pump, better nutrient delivery, and potentially stronger endurance. That does not automatically mean more muscle gain, but it can support higher-quality sessions. If you train hard and feel like your output fades too soon, circulation support may help.

For daily life, some men report steadier energy and less of that heavy, sluggish feeling. The effect is not like a stimulant hit. It is usually more subtle and more useful - better physical responsiveness instead of jittery energy.

For sexual wellness, blood flow support matters because erection quality depends heavily on circulation. That said, low performance can also be tied to hormones, stress, sleep, medication effects, or cardiovascular issues. If the problem is persistent, supplements should not be your only move.

How to choose the right formula

This is where a lot of men get burned. The label says circulation support, but the formula is really just caffeine, a sprinkle of herbs, and marketing copy.

Start with the ingredient panel. Look for recognizable circulation-support compounds such as citrulline, arginine, beet root, and targeted plant extracts. If everything is packed into a proprietary blend with no clear amounts, that is a red flag. You want transparency.

Next, look at quality signals. Third-party testing, GMP-certified manufacturing, and FDA-compliant operations matter because they speak to consistency and safety. Men who care about performance should care just as much about what is actually in the bottle.

Then consider your goal. If you want better gym pumps and training stamina, a nitric oxide-focused formula makes sense. If your bigger concern is intimate performance or all-day vitality, you may want a formula that combines blood flow support with energy, libido, or stress-management ingredients. The right stack depends on where your performance is falling off.

When you should be more cautious

Circulation support is not for autopilot use. If you take medication for blood pressure, heart conditions, chest pain, or erectile dysfunction, speak with your healthcare provider before using a circulation supplement. The same goes if you have a known cardiovascular condition or symptoms like dizziness, chest discomfort, or unusual shortness of breath.

More is not better here. Some men stack multiple nitric oxide products, pre-workouts, and performance formulas at once, then wonder why they feel off. Keep your routine tight and intentional. If you are using a targeted circulation product, make sure you know what else in your stack affects blood pressure, blood flow, or stimulation.

How to get better results from them

The formula matters, but so does the environment you give it. Hydration is a big one. Poor hydration can kill workout pumps and make circulation support feel underwhelming. If you are sweating hard, training fasted, or living on coffee, fix that first.

Movement matters too. Even the best supplement works better when paired with regular exercise, especially resistance training and walking. Long periods of sitting can work against the exact outcome you want.

Sleep and body composition also play a role. Men carrying excess weight or sleeping five hours a night often expect a supplement to clean up a much bigger problem. It usually will not. But if you tighten up those basics, a strong circulation formula can become noticeably more effective.
